The Jhua Hot Wire Foam Cutter is a 15W electric tool that heats up to 150°C within 10 seconds, enabling smooth, debris-free cuts on low-density styrofoam. Lightweight and ergonomically designed, it features a durable stainless steel wire that can be shaped once for custom cuts. Ideal for arts, crafts, DIY projects, and model making, this tool offers professional-grade precision and ease of use for creative professionals and hobbyists alike.

Works great once you figure out how to use it.
I found a few reviews that said the rod broke off almost immediately. I can see how that could happen. It starts to bend greatly if you are trying to go too fast. It is a slow process but is neat and clean unlike using a knife or saw. Then I figured out if you use a sawing action (up and down) while using, it moves quicker and easier. I also turned it when it started to bend a lot in one direction. I hope this helps someone!

Not worth the hassle
Bought this to trim some styrofoam insulation and less than impressed. This thing does not have enough power to stay hot enough to get through a 4 foot length of material. The hot knife “blade” being a flimsy 1/16 inch metal wire bends as soon as the blade cools slightly. Ended up having to make multiple passes to get through material. Gave up and went back to drywall saw and clean up the mess after. This being the flimsiest option for foam cutter is not worth the cheapness as its basically useless. For anyone wanting to complain about the smell.. what do you expect heating up and my melting polystyrene. It’s going to smell terrible but thats not a defect of any hot knife.I should have spend a few bucks more and got the sturdier version thats better able to maintain heat. Oh well.
